The Arizona D-Backs finished thirty-three games behind the leader during the 1998 season, yet still drew one of the largest attendance figures in baseball. During the 1998 season the Arizona Diamondacks had their largest franchise attendance when 3,600,412 fans attended games at Bank One Ballpark.
